Output 66400615ee18d658dd6d160a8635490fff805966e422a6155a8d8980a09e0364:0

value
129000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dea928796d57f4d379c6b551ea895c5232fb9e2a8f8acd550e8ff4f916c947a
address
bc1peh4f9puk64l56duudd23a2y4c53jlw0z4ru2e42sarl5lytvj3aqzcsdsl
transaction
66400615ee18d658dd6d160a8635490fff805966e422a6155a8d8980a09e0364
spent
true